5.39.5 Buy Men's Sweat Tops Calvin Klein Golf Essentials Online | Next Australia
Free delivery over $100, we pay all duties

0
  • christmas
  • boys
  • girls
  • baby
  • women
  • men
  • brands
  • home

1 Products

Men's Sweat Tops Calvin Klein Golf Essentials

Calvin Klein Golf Newport Quarter Zip Sweatshirt (AT5219) | $81